• Jackie Gonzalez joined Echo Horizon in 2024 and is excited to work alongside Ellis Enlow as one of the Pre-K Teachers. She grew up in northern California and moved to the LA area to attend California State University Northridge. After graduating with her B.A. in Child and Adolescent Development, she got her multiple-subject teaching credential and began teaching first grade at Coeur D’Alene Elementary in Venice. While teaching, she was selected to be a fellow of the COTSEN Art of Teaching Program, where she participated in a two-year mentorship focused on reading instruction. In her pursuit of life-long learning, she next earned her Masters in Curriculum Design and Instruction from Concordia University of Irvine. Fascinated by the ways young people think about mathematics, she began working with the UCLA Math Project to support fellow teachers in their mathematics instruction. While she is not teaching, she loves to spend time with her Los Angeles-born and raised husband, dog and baby boy. Jackie loves to hike, road trip to visit family, go to the beach, cook and spend lots of quality time with her little one.
